Even without 4Kids' edits, Pokémon: The First Movie has too many problems to really be good. It's too dark for a film based off a comical adventure TV series; characters get to make long speeches consisting of their name, &it's written like a mystery, without any real mystery.

I did not like the 3rd movie; it had some cool segments, but it made little sense.

The 2nd movie is almost good; I blame 4Kids for it's problems; they tried to force a couple of morals in there which came off as heavy handed.

I liked the 4th movie a lot, but the CGI is really dated, & a lot of people dislike it, so I can't consider it good.

Flash Gordon is fun.
